Ayers Rock, Northern Territory

 

Uluru

Since I had wanted to visit this hauntingly beautiful site for a long time, I was very happy to be able to experience the beauty of the place.  Although the hellishly hot weather (42°C) prevented me from climbing the hill, I enjoyed the visit very much.

Kata Tjuta

Kata Tjuta (Many Heads) is another famous rock formation in the Uluru-Kata Tjuta National Park.  We hiked into the Walpa Gorge as well as into the Valley of the Winds in the morning while it was still not very hot.
